A Canadian chain of Mumbai street-food restaurants has picked Manchester for their first CT location and second in the United States!
Royal Paan is coming soon to 1000 Tolland Turnpike in Manchester, a portion of the former Randy's Wooster Street Pizza Shop near BJ's Wholesale. Work is underway to divide the former pizza shop into two spaces, one for Royal Paan and one still available for lease. The menu consists of authentic Indian paan, masala, Faloonda, Kulfi, Vegetarian Street Food, Dosa, Chaat, a variety of delicious milkshakes, and other Mumbai-style Street Food delicacies. Hartford Healthcare has won their bid to purchase Manchester Memorial Hospital, Rockville General Hospital, and other ECHN assets at a bankruptcy auction.
Hartford Healthcare bid of $86.1 million to acquire both hospitals. The bid was the only one received by the deadline of the auction on October 16th. Hartford Healthcare's new subsidiary, ECHN Holdings, was designated as the successful bidder. The sale is still subject to court approval, with Thursday set as the last day for objections to the sale to be entered. U-Haul will feature 2 new buildings, one new 3-story tall building (with nearly 110,000 square feet of spread across the 3 floors), and a smaller 13,795 square foot building at the rear for U-Box units. The facility will be constructed at 77 Spencer Street, the 7 acre property between VAS Auto and UHaul's existing facility; the space was once home to 2 house and a barn. A new multi-tenant building is planned for 755 Silver Lane in East Hartford; a vacant lot once home to Friendly's many years ago. The site has sat empty since the buildng was demolished in 2015. The site is located next to Domino's on Silver Lane. The new building would be roughly 3,800 square feet with Wing Stop occupying 1,617 square feet and Five Guys occupying 2,244 square feet. The remainder of the space is a maintenance room. Five Guys would feature a small pation in front of their restaurant. Plans for the building were approved at the Planning & Zoning Commission's September 10th meeting. No timeline was announced for construction or the opening of either business. Plans include 232 apartments spread across four 48-unit buildings and four 10-unit buildings. Separate garage parking will be provided adajcent to the 48 unit buildings. Buildings would be comprised of a mix of studio, 1 bedroom, and two bedroom units. Plans also include a club house with a pool, 2 pickleball courts, and a dog park. A connection to the Cheney Rail Trail is also depicted in the plans. Two new commercial buildings are included in the plans on Broad Street, each would be roughly 4,000 square feet. Building are show butting up to Broad Street with parking in the rear. The developer behind the complex is APH Manchester, LLC also known as Anthony Properties.
